China is one of the major banana planting countries among the world, and the output of banana in China is about five to six thousand tons. but only little of the byproduct, such as banana bast, banana leaf, banana stem, was produced into rope, sack, handbag and other textured products, most of them was discarded as garbage. This can not only cause the waste of resource, but also the environmental pollution.As a natural cellulosic fiber, the exploitation of banana fiber can not only replace the consumption of chemical fibers partly, but also satisfy people's psychological and physical demand for enjoying life and nature.Based on the chemical component quantitative analysis of banana bast, the paper compared it with other bast fibers, which guide/point out the right direction for degumming; the enzyme combined chemical degumming process was used to extract the banana fiber by referring to other bast fibers' degumming process and taking full advantage of enzyme and chemical degumming process. At last, the basic physical properties and the structure of banana fiber are studied. The conclusions are as follows:(1) Both the percentage of hemi-cellulose and lignin in banana bast are high, which is 23.52~25.04% and 13~14% respectively. The high percentage of lignin must cause difficulty in degumming the banana bast. So how to remove lignin is the key point of the study.(2) Among the four pretreatment methods chosen, that is immerse, pickling, ultrasonic and immerse combined ultrasonic, the effect and efficiency of pickling on removing pectin is superior to other pretreatments. The parameter of the process are: concentrationof H2SO4 2g/L, bath ratio1:20, bath temperature 50℃, time 2h, normal pressure.(3) The primary chemical degumming process of banana fiber was taken as the follow route:Sample preparation→pickling→washing→alkali liquor boiling→washing stamping→acid washing→washing→dehydration→oiling→dehydration→loosing→drying→banana fiber.The parameters of each process are:Pickling: concentration of H2SO4 2g/L, bath rationl: 20, water bath heating at 50℃, time 2h, normal pressure;Alkali-H2O2 one-bath boiling: concentration of NaOH 8g/L, H2O2 6g/L, Na2SiO3 3%, boiling under normal pressure, bath ratio 1:20, time3h, heat-up time 35~40min;Souring: concentration of H2O4 2g/L, bath ration1:20, time 2~3min, normal tempreture and pressure;Oil finish: BSK1.5%, 10min, normal tempreture.The residual pectin and lignin of the degummed fibers got are 6.94% and 3.93% respectively.(4) Based on the chemical degumming process, the enzyme combined chemical degumming process was taken as follow:Sample preparation→pickling→washing→enzyme treatment→hot water washing→alkali liquor boiling→washing stamping→acid washing→washing→dehydration→oiling→dehydration→loosing→drying→banana fiber.The parameters of each process are:Enzyme treatment: owf10%; time8 h; pH 8, 55℃, bath ratio1:20; other parameters are the same as that used in the chemical degumming process.(5) Under the best process condition, banana fiber has a primary ability in spinning, with its strength 88.63cN, extension3.11%, fineness 3.13tex.(6) Based on the measurement of banana fiber's shape structure, the surface of banana fiber is silky and has convolutions, with cross marking of some fibers. It shows the banana fiber has the shape characteristic of cotton and bast fibers.(7) Based on the infrared spectral and X-ray diffraction analysis of banana bast, it has the characteristic group of cellulosic fiber, the crystallization degree and degree of orientation are 61.55% and 0.8690.Based on study of the dissertation, the author believes the banana fiber is of great exploitation value as a newly zoology fiber.
